1. Grouse
Bibliography (pdf file) compiled and
continuously maintained by Don Wolfe,
presented by species,
more complete for North American grouse species than for European
and Asian species, but always useful.
From October 2005, it still
contains primarily manuscripts in English, but should contain the
majority of manuscripts from outside of North America that ARE in
English. From February 2006, papers in German, in French or in
other language with an English summary are also included. In June 2007, it contains nearly 6000 citations. The pdf file is to download from the Sutton Avian Research Center website: http://www.suttoncenter.org/pubs.html . Don Wolfe updates the file every month or two, so check yourself the link!

Norman, G. W., D. F.
Stauffer, J. Sole, T. J. Allen, W. K. Igo, S. Bittner, J. Edwards,
R. L. Kirkpatrick, W. M. Giuliano, B. Tefft, C. Harper, B.
Buehler, D. Figert, M. Steamster, and D. Swanson.
2004. Ruffed Grouse ecology and management in the
Appalachian region. Final project report of the Appalachian
Cooperative Grouse Research Project. 61pp.
* Editors note: The ACGRP final report is truly a monumental
accomplishment, summarizing multi-state RUGR research conducted
between 1996 and 2003. The study investigated aspects of
the life history, ecology, and management of ruffed grouse over 6
years in 8 states. The report can be downloaded at: http://www.dgif.state.va.us/hunting/va_game_wildlife/grouse_project.pdf or at http://www.ruffedgrousesociety.org/pdf/ACGRPFinal.pdf
